The minimal interior lets the food do the talking , interjecting with a few ultra-mod touches like blue LED lights under the bar and abstract art on the walls . Chef Wayne Martin , building on the success of his previous venture ( CRAVE , in Vancouver ) has hit on a winning formula for keeping the classic bar and grill fresh .
Classy comfort food is the name of the game , including pub staples spiked with upmarket ingredients and served on trendy ceramics . The signature burger ( upgraded with pancetta and truffle-infused cheese ) and a gooey , open-faced grilled cheese topped with classic caprese flavours ( pesto , a thick slice of tomato , and buffalo mozzarella ) show what the kitchen can do with bar food .
Entrées offer a mix of homey and high cuisine . Rigatoni in a winey tomato sauce wins the prize for best rainy day dish . Tender shreds of short rib folded into the sauce impart rich , dusky flavour . Bison rib eye is the hip answer to meat-and-potato Sunday dinners , avoiding the lean protein ' s pitfalls by presenting a luscious cut that releases juices happily into a ragout of bacon and fingerling potatoes .
But diner demand ensures the menu is not all carbs and carnivore fare . Lighter options - including many suitable for vegans - are equally delicious . Salads are no afterthought , but creative and fresh menu additions , like the classic cobb amped up with crunchy-coated fried chicken . A raw salad piled with 15 different veggies ( edamame , sun-dried tomato , and fennel are the MVPs ) lets veg shine , spiked with a healthy toss of milky ,
sharp green goddess dressing .
A warm , caramel scented sticky toffee pudding is the perfect way to cap off a homey meal , though the night need not end there . Go ahead , have a drink – or two , or three – what else are neighbourhood spots for ?
Capital Grill & Bar is open Tue-Sat 11 am - 10 pm , Sun 11 am - 9 pm .
